This is an annoying behaviour, when quitting Photoshop it would unexpectedly quit (sounds odd, I know, but I prefer "expected" quits!) While this is annoying, there is no harm done if all documents were saved and closed first. If the following Plug-in is removed, the unexpectedly quit problem does not happen.
Note 1: This means open the "Applications" folder, then the "Adobe Photoshop CS5" folder, then the "Plug-ins" folder, then the "Extensions" folder, then find the file "ScriptingSupport.plugin", and delete it.
Note 2: If you require scripting support do not delete this, but you will have to put up with the unexpected quits. If you are unsure, move the file to another location, instead of deleting it, then you can put it back if required.
I usually write a blog post about once a week. The latest post can be viewed here: Garbage: Democracy dies in darkness, especially when it is buried in garbage! (posted 2024-11-01 at 12:31:14). I do podcasts too!. You can listen to my latest podcast, here: OJB's Podcast 2024-08-22 Stirring Up Trouble: Let's just get every view out there and fairly debate them..